John Hornby Skewes & Co. Ltd., commonly known as JHS, has supplied musical instruments and accessories to the UK music trade since 1965. Its extensive portfolio covers fretted instruments, amplification, effects, live sound, wireless equipment, accessories, orchestral products and music education.

Which Brands Can I Find in This Collection?
The Fair Deal Music JHS Brands collection may include products from established guitar, accessory and performance-equipment manufacturers such as:
- Vintage – electric guitars, bass guitars, acoustic guitars, travel instruments, ukuleles, accessories and artist-inspired designs.
- Godin – distinctive Canadian-made electric, acoustic and multi-voice instruments designed for demanding players.
- Seagull – acoustic and electro-acoustic guitars covering accessible instruments through to professional performance models.
- Art & Lutherie – characterful acoustic guitars with traditional styling and musician-friendly designs.
- Danelectro – unmistakable electric guitars and basses with retro styling and distinctive tones.
- Pilgrim – folk instruments including banjos and related instruments for traditional, country and roots musicians.
- Xvive – compact wireless systems, audio tools and performance technology for musicians, studios and live venues.

Understanding the Vintage Guitar Ranges
Vintage is one of the most prominent brands within the JHS portfolio, offering a broad selection of electric, acoustic and bass guitars. Different ranges are designed around particular playing needs, styles and budgets.
- Vintage Coaster Series – accessible instruments and packages designed to help new and developing musicians get started.
- Vintage ReIssued Series – familiar, musician-friendly guitar and bass designs with modern components and practical performance features.
- Vintage ICON Series – instruments with deliberately aged finishes and a played-in visual character.
- Vintage REVO Series – distinctive designs that combine vintage influences with more individual styling and modern versatility.
- Vintage Signature Series – artist-associated instruments developed around particular sounds, specifications and playing preferences.

How to Choose the Right Instrument or Equipment
Think About Where You Will Use It
An instrument for home practice may have different requirements from one intended for regular rehearsals, recording sessions or live performances. Consider portability, amplification, connectivity and durability as well as sound and appearance.
Choose a Comfortable Body Shape and Size
Full-size, short-scale, parlour, travel and compact instruments can feel very different. Younger musicians, players with a smaller reach and anyone who travels regularly may benefit from a more compact design.
Compare Pickups and Electronics
Pickup type can make a major difference to the sound and response of an electric guitar or bass. Electro-acoustic instruments also vary in their onboard controls and amplified performance. Check each product specification carefully and consider the styles of music you intend to play.
Allow for Essential Accessories
You may also need a suitable amplifier, cable, case, strap, stand, tuner, power supply or wireless system. Review what is included with the product before ordering so that you have everything required to begin playing or performing.

What does JHS Brands mean?
In this collection, JHS refers to John Hornby Skewes & Co. Ltd., a long-established UK trade distributor of musical instruments, accessories, amplification and audio equipment. The collection contains selected products from brands supplied through JHS.
Is this collection only for JHS guitar pedals?
No. JHS Brands in this context refers to the John Hornby Skewes distribution portfolio, rather than exclusively to the effects-pedal brand with a similar name. Check the brand and product information on each listing to confirm exactly what you are viewing.
